Federal agents seized more than a ton of marijuana worth about $1 million in an abandoned tractor-trailer rig in Rio Rico.

On Thursday, a Border Patrol drug dog alerted to the presence of drugs in the trailer that was on a dirt lot on Avenida Acaponeta, according to a news release from Immigration and Customs Enforcement.

Agents with ICE's Homeland Security Investigations were called in and determined the trailer had a false registered owner.

The trailer was searched and 157 packages of marijuana β€” about 2,081 pounds β€” were found concealed in cardboard watermelon containers, ICE said.

The investigation is continuing. This is the second largest marijuana seizure in 2015 for ICE's Homeland Security Investigations in Nogales.
